Role Description
We are looking for a DevOps Engineer with expertise in Node.js to manage our AWS infrastructure, set up CI/CD pipelines and ensure the reliability of our backend systems. The ideal candidate will have experience in cloud-based solutions, backend development, and continuous delivery practices to drive efficiency and scalability. The DevOps Engineer will be responsible for Infrastructure as Code (IaC) implementation, software development, continuous integration, system administration and Linux operations.
Responsibilities
- Manage and optimize AWS services (EC2, S3, RDS, Lambda, IAM).
- Design and implement CI/CD pipelines using tools like GitHub Actions, Jenkins, or AWS CodePipeline.
- Develop, maintain and deploy Node.js applications and REST APIs.
- Monitor infrastructure using tools like AWS CloudWatch and Grafana.
- Troubleshoot and resolve production issues to minimize downtime.
- Implement server, API, and database security best practices.
- Implement load balancing, auto-scaling and failover mechanisms.
- Configure IAM roles and policies for secure AWS operations.
- Work closely with developers to ensure seamless integration of backend APIs with frontend applications.
- Implement security best practices for servers, APIs, and databases.
Qualifications
- Hands-on experience with EC2, S3, RDS, IAM, VPC, CloudFront and Lambda.
- Infrastructure as Code (IaC) proficiency
- Software Development and Continuous Integration skills
- Hands-on experience with CI/CD tools (Jenkins, GitHub Actions)
- System Administration and Linux expertise
- Familiarity with Docker (Kubernetes is a plus).
- Strong skills in Node.js and Express.js.
- Proficiency in MongoDB or PostgreSQL
- Strong problem-solving and troubleshooting abilities
What we have
- Competitive salary and performance-based bonuses.
- Collaborative, fun, entrepreneurial and innovative work environment with like-minded coworkers.
- Opportunities for career advancement and growth.
- Industry experienced people to guide and mentor you towards the achievement of results.